What Are Browser-Based IDEs?
Browser-based IDEs are online coding environments that provide developers with the tools they need to write and manage code from any device with internet access. They typically include features such as:
- Code editing with syntax highlighting
- Real-time collaboration
- Integrated debugging tools
- Version control
- Deployment capabilities
These features make browser-based IDEs a viable option for individual developers, teams, and even educational settings.

Benefits of Using Browser-Based IDEs in Modern Workflows
Adopting a browser-based IDE can significantly improve your coding workflow. Here are some of the primary benefits:
1. Enhanced Collaboration
One of the standout features of browser-based IDEs is the ability to collaborate in real-time. Developers can work together on the same codebase, making it easy to share ideas, debug issues, and learn from each other. This is particularly useful for remote teams or coding boot camps.
2. Reduced Setup Time
Setting up a local development environment can be time-consuming and prone to errors. With a browser-based IDE like CodeBridge, you can start coding immediately without worrying about configurations or dependencies.
3. Cross-Platform Compatibility
Browser-based IDEs are inherently cross-platform, allowing developers to work on any operating system with a web browser. This flexibility ensures that you can switch devices without losing your progress or encountering compatibility issues.
4. Automatic Updates
With traditional IDEs, you often need to manually update your software to access new features or security patches. Browser-based IDEs handle updates automatically, ensuring that you always have the latest tools at your disposal.

Challenges of Browser-Based IDEs
While browser-based IDEs offer numerous advantages, they are not without challenges. Some potential drawbacks include:
- Internet Dependency: A stable internet connection is essential for using browser-based IDEs. This can be a limitation in areas with poor connectivity.
- Performance Limitations: Browser-based environments may not perform as well as local installations, especially for resource-intensive projects.
- Security Concerns: Storing code in the cloud can raise security concerns, particularly for sensitive projects. It’s crucial to choose a reputable IDE with robust security measures.
